I really enjoyed the film but I do have a few beefs with some of the plot line.

1) Only the movies are official canon and yet, there is no Sith or Darth for the Dark Side... it's only "The Dark Side."  OK, well all 6 movies had either a reference to the Sith or the "Dark Jedi" had Darth as their official first name... Instead, we get "Supreme Leader" and Kylo.

2) So... Rey, who has no memory of where she comes from or who she is, can all of a sudden out Force-maneuver AND out lightsaber-duel a Dark Jedi who initially learned from Luke and then Supreme Leader Snoke...... WITHOUT ANY TRAINING?!

3) Number 2 goes hand-in-hand with this beef... there seems to have been some rushing with the story because Rey somehow knows how to use the force fairly quickly, when it took Luke and other Jedi months to years to master basic maneuvers.

4) Captain Phasma had so much damn hype and played a MINIMAL ROLE!!! What the hell!?  I was expecting some sort of epic play and got nothing.

5) Kylo Ren is obsessed with finishing what Vader started and yet as ZERO clue that he was born to bring balance to the force and was the only known Jedi to turn to the Dark Side AND THEN TURN BACK TO THE LIGHTSIDE!!! How does he not know his own Grandfather's epic story?? THAT'S WHY VADER WAS A BAD-ASS MO FO!!

 

The things I TRULY enjoyed...

1) The old guard... oh boy was it nice to see them.  Even Carrie Fisher with her inability to move her lips still conveyed a strength in Leia.  Han Solo was hilarious as were Chewie's reactions.  Seeing Hamill as Luke, who seems to have finally embraced what Star Wars did for his career after years of fighting it, was AWESOME and he had a silent bad-assdom that Alec Guinness couldn't pull off.

2) I think it's clear that Rey is Luke's daughter, I mean, why else would she react, and the Force react to her, like that when she touched his lightsaber?

3) Adam Driver was AWESOME!!!! The fact that his character is actually a Solo, I kind of didn't see it coming.  Every indication was he was a huge fan of Vader, but there was no reason given as to why.  Well, aren't we all kind of HUGE fans of our Grandfathers?  I get it and I liked it, despite a little beef.

4) The scenes on Jakku with the Millennium Falcon were pretty epic in 3D.  Another reference to it being garbage was classic, but damn was it nice seeing that freighter in action again.

5) Finn... I really dig the character and it kind of shows that not every Stormtrooper was a thoughtless, shotless moron.  He didn't like it, and did what he had to do to get out.  How many of us would be able to do that?  I would try, even if it killed me, so yea, I like it.

6) The new X-Wings... OMG, I loved them... even down to the light underneath.  I thought that was a really nice touch.

7) Homages to the original trilogy, even using Starkiller, in a very wise manor, was a lot of fun.  Yea, there were maybe a few too many winks and direct pulls, but overall, it was a lot of fun.
